God Be Bound
Legions of Angels, stand by my side,
under His wing, He gives a place to hide.
The Angels are prepared, for war you see,
they camp, on everyside of me.
Dressed for battle, they are prepared,
as the enemy of darkness in fear, is scared.
Shaking and trembling, they smell defeat,
off they hide, to their own retreat.
If you are a child of God, be careful what you do,
we can tie, all the Angles hands, before we can tie one shoe.
Listen to me careful, Warring Angels, all around,
in your life, better hope, your Angels are not bound.
What we do and what we say, carry heavy weight,
those things we think we hide, who could anticipate.
If therefore, the Angels of God be bound,
where in this picture, can God be found.
Hands tied, by our words and deeds,
as we get angry with Him, for not supplying our needs.
If God and His Angels are bound by us you see,
where does that now, put you and me.
We got twisted, it should be the other way around,
it’s the devil and his demons, that’s supposed to be bound.
Don’t wanna open up the gates of hell, letting more demons in,
now we have to turn around, face them all again.
With the wisdom of time, the knowledge of the past,
The presence of the future,
the battles never last.
To untie what was tied, to tie what was untied, you see,
in the spiritual world, where Warring Angels, encamps around you and me.
